I'm getting married at the end of July, for the honeymoon, we are planning on driving from Málaga to Athens, which via France and Italy then following coast roads from Croatia down is about 9000km return, plus incidental driving to see sights.

The car is in good condition throughout. 135000km. Timing belt has been done. I'm going to change the battery as it's 3-4 years old and will check hoses and aux belts over. Will give it an oil change, filters etc... I carry a reasonable toolkit and have a solar panel to top battery up.

Is there anything specific I should check, that gets overlooked? It's going to be longest trip I've done. We've got European breakdown cover, but some places like Albania and Bosnia are a bit of an unknown.

As far as truck preparation goes there's not much the 90 series needs , grease the UJ's and props is about all i can think of apart from the obvious things like making sure all your fluids are topped up and your wheel nuts are tight .

I did 5000 miles in a fortnight without problems but got a few leaking seals after arriving home , perhaps because the truck was parked up for 6 or 7 weeks , and i do wonder if some additives in different oils with a view to conditioning seals before i set off might have prevented this .

If you have doubts about fuel quality anywhere along your trip a disposable inline filter just before the pump might be an idea so if she starts playing up you can change that and the proper fuel filter and be on your way without worrying about what got into the pump .
